| kljesta64 said: what are the perfect specifications for this emulator to play properly ? |
I'd say it depends on which resolution you want to play at. Any modern CPU is reasonably capable to play DS games at native res. This version of the emulator (which is not an official version and isn't updated) has given some people with i7's (but low clocked ones < 3.0ghz) trouble, while it runs fine for the more popular games on my overclocked (4.4ghz) Pentium G3258. You can play the games at 2x, 3x, and 4x res as well.Also I'd expect a discrete card with at least 1gb of GDDR3 (or better) Ram would be enough for the GPU end of things if you want to play at 4x res. Some games work better than others for me. I noticed slow-down and sound issue in Goldeneye when I increased the resolution, but I might be able to fix that if I tweaked settings. Also I noticed that neither my CPU or GPU was getting loaded to max, so it might just be a coding problem in the emulator. If you want more information, google "HD DS Emulator." | yoscrafty said: It bothers me that companies don't bother upscaling classic game on their virtual shop (eshop/psn/live) on powerful consoles. I think Banjo-Kazooie on Xbox360 did, but I know that a lot of PS1 classic I own on PS3 are direct port without upscaling. It should be easy no? |
Well these games are being natively rendered at these resolutions (not upscaled), but yeah if random people with no documentation can make an emulator that renders games at higher resolutions on open platforms, it shouldn't be too hard for a team to be dedicated at these big named companies to achieve something better on a closed platform. I think their biggest concern is accuracy. They don't want to make a general emulator because they want all games to be 100% accurate; however, the accuracy in these emulators is fine enough for consumers in my opinion, and these big name developers can accomplish much more, especially considering they have documentation of both hardware and know how it works. Furthermore, they can have an configuration file that sets the emulator to the proper settings for each individual game. There is no reason why the PS4 shouldn't be able to emulate PS1 games at 1080p 4 xAA for example that is reasonably accurate. Possibly they think the marginal costs are too high for a measly marginal benefit.
